Biography of Jaye Davidson
Jaye Davidson was born on March 21, 1968, in Elstree, Hertfordshire, England. His early life was marked by a blend of cultural influences, as his father was Ghanaian and his mother was English. This diverse background contributed to his unique perspective and charisma, which would later define his acting career.

Early Life and Background
Jaye Davidson's early life was relatively unremarkable compared to the fame he would later achieve. Growing up in a multicultural household, Davidson developed a keen sense of identity and self-awareness from a young age. His father's Ghanaian heritage and his mother's English roots provided him with a rich cultural tapestry that influenced his worldview.
Before entering the world of acting, Davidson worked as a model. His striking looks and androgynous features caught the attention of photographers and designers, leading to opportunities in the fashion industry. However, Davidson's ambitions extended beyond modeling, and he eventually found himself drawn to acting.
Career Breakthrough: The Crying Game
Davidson's career breakthrough came with his role as Dil in Neil Jordan's *The Crying Game* (1992). The film, a psychological thriller with elements of romance and political intrigue, was both critically acclaimed and controversial. Davidson's portrayal of Dil, a transgender woman, was groundbreaking at the time and challenged societal norms surrounding gender and identity.
His performance was widely praised for its sensitivity and depth. Critics noted that Davidson brought authenticity and nuance to the role, making Dil a memorable and complex character. The film's success catapulted Davidson into the spotlight, earning him an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or.
Stargate and Other Notable Roles
Following the success of *The Crying Game*, Davidson landed a role in the science fiction epic *Stargate* (1994). Directed by Roland Emmerich, the film was a commercial success and further solidified Davidson's status as a versatile actor. In *Stargate*, he played the role of Ra, an alien overlord, showcasing his ability to adapt to different genres and character types.

Retirement from Acting
Despite his early success, Jaye Davidson made the surprising decision to retire from acting after just two major films. His reasons for stepping away from Hollywood remain largely personal, but many speculate that his aversion to fame and the pressures of the industry played a significant role.
Davidson's retirement was abrupt but deliberate. He expressed a desire to live a private life away from the public eye, choosing to focus on personal pursuits rather than continuing his acting career. This decision only added to his mystique, leaving fans and critics alike wondering about the untapped potential of his talent.
